Título:
Mechanical Properties of Modified Chitosan Films
Autor/es:
MARIANA MONACHESI; NORA RODRÍGUEZ; DANIEL ERCOLI; GRACIELA GOIZUETA
Lugar:
Río de Janeiro - Brasil
Reunión:
Congreso; World Polymer Congress - 41ST International Symposium on Macromolecules (Macro 2006); 2006
Resumen:
The aim of this work is to study the swelling characteristics and mechanical properties of films of chitosan and two derivatives N-methylene phosphonic chitosan (NMPC) and poly (ethylene glycol)aldehyde-crosslinked N-methylene phosphonic chitosan (NMPC-PEG-CHO). Modulus of elasticity (E), tensile strength (TS) and elongation at break (%EL) of films were determined on an Instron Tester. It was found that swelling of NMPC-PEG-CHO is about 960% while NMPC is totally soluble. All materials showed a brittle behavior and E and %EL values decreased considerably for both of the chitosan derivatives.
